My Manifesto as Vice President Community and Welfare.
My first objective as Vice President Community and Welfare will be working with the Islamic Society to negotiate with the university to improve their prayer rooms on all of the campuses and I will work to have the better advertisement to information about the prayer rooms to students.
My second objective as Vice President Community and Welfare will be working on eliminating the stigma around mental health through two ways. Firstly I will expand the Look After Your Mate campaign that I've been working on as Community and Welfare Officer this year to establish the workshops that help people having a conversation with their friends when they are going through a tough time. Secondly, I will work with the Wellbeing Service, the Mental Health Campaign and the Psychology department to create monthly videos about the realities of having a specific mental health difficulty like OCD compared to the stereotypes that it is associated with.
My last objective as Vice President Community and Welfare will be looking into establishing an automatic announcement system for blackboard service to inform students when it is malfunctioning. This will help students be told of the problem earlier and will avoid frustration especially when there are deadlines and during the exam period.
